Ticket: Load test against Tollgrove checkout hitting 401s. The Hammerfall load rig is pointed at the staging checkout flow, but every payment-confirm call fails auth, so the test never exercises the order-commit path. Root cause: the rig's env file was copied from the old perf cluster and is missing the staging payment-gateway entry. Fix is straightforward — open the rig's .env, keep the existing TARGET_URL and concurrency settings, and add the missing entry. The staging gateway credential should sit on the next line.

env line for fafof-fahag: LEDGER_TOKEN5=f8790

**Q: Can I bulk-edit rows in the Vantle admin table?**

Yes. Select rows with the checkboxes, then use the Actions dropdown. Bulk edits apply immediately — no draft state, no undo. Limit batches to 200 rows or the job queue stalls. Don't bulk-edit anything in the Billing column without sign-off from the Ledger team. Full field-by-field rules are documented on the internal wiki page below.

operations page: https://confluence.qorvellabs.internal/projects/projects/projects/pages/a358

## EXIF Scrubber — Data Stores

The Pixelwash service strips EXIF metadata from every upload before anything hits the Glintvale CDN. Scrub results (hash, fields removed, timestamp) land in the `scrub_audit` table so reviewers can verify nothing leaked. Yes, GPS tags are always dropped, no exceptions. The audit database is reachable with the following.

replica DSN, kajep-yahag: mssql://praok_svc:iF@db-8d68.plorvaio.local:5432/eliion

14:22 — Consent banner (Glimmerbay rollout) goes to 100% of traffic. Within ten minutes, support starts seeing reports that the "decline all" button does nothing on older tablets — turns out the click handler depended on an API the webview didn't have. Ops flipped the rollout back to 5% at 14:41 while Priya's team shipped a polyfill. If a customer mentions a frozen banner, they were almost certainly on the bad build; confirm by asking them to read off the token shown below.

trace token, taguf-fadup: htk6_1d42c5

// Canary gate thresholds for Larkspur deploys. Promotion blocked if
// error rate exceeds CANARY_MAX_ERR over a 10-minute window, or if p99
// latency regresses more than 8% versus baseline. Rollback is automatic;
// no manual override without on-call sign-off. Values tuned after the
// Quillford incident. The gating build that validated these numbers is
// recorded below.

pipeline stamp: htk9_ce63042d9